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
Receives copy of purchase order, receiving reports, bills of lading, delivery receipts, and files them temporarily by vendors.- Matches vendor invoices with purchase orders and receiving documents. Any discrepancy should be addressed and cleared with the appropriate personnel.
- Prepares matched invoices and input for payment and forwards it to the Accounting Manager for review and approval.
- Generates and verifies the list of invoices which are due for payment each week.
- Matches paid vouchers with checks and forwards them to the check signatories for signature.
- Mails signed checks to vendors and files copies appropriately by vendors.
- Inputs new vendors and updates automated vendor listing whenever necessary.
- Requests vendor’s Employer Identification Number (EIN) for federal form 1099 purposes.
- Reconciles intercompany and other vendor accounts.
- Assists in the preparation of business plans/annual budget.
- Maintains retention of vendor files and accounting records in the storage room.
- Attends other matters which the Accounting Manager and/or the Director of Operations may assign from time to time.
